1. Scope
Wireless Application Protocol (WAP) is a result of continuous work to define an industry wide specification for
developing applications that operate over wireless communication networks. The scope for the WAP Forum is to define
a set of specifications to be used by service applications. The wireless market is growing very quickly and reaching new
customers and providing new services. To enable operators and manufacturers to meet the challenges in advanced
services, differentiation, and fast/flexible service creation, WAP defines a set of protocols in transport, session and
application layers. For additional information on the WAP architecture, refer to “Wireless Application Protocol
Architecture Specification” [WAP].
This specification defines the Service Indication (SI) content type, which is an application of the Extensible Markup
Language (XML) 1.0 [XML]. The content type provides a means to notify a client that an external asynchronous event
has occurred and indicate a service that can be loaded in order to react to that event. This is accomplished by sending a
message to the client that informs the end-user about the event, and a URI from where the appropriate service can be
loaded. For example, the message could read “You have new voice mails”, and the URI points to the voice mail service.
The SI content type does also allow the level of user-intrusiveness to be controlled, deletion of SIs stored on a client
(both manually and automatically by using the concept of expiration), and replacement of stored SIs. A mechanism to
resolve race conditions is also specified. Finally, WBXML [WBXML] tokens are defined to allow for efficient
over-the-air transmission.
